Thanks, I booked an itinerary with several days in JNB, and then a several-day London stopover for $5081.68 USD.
The YVR-JNB (connecting in LHR) part of the itinerary is split class:
- J in their A350 (it’s the newish Club Suites product, with doors; the highest class on that plane.)
- F in their A380
Then the flight from JNB-LHR is F in the A380 again, and finally several days later from LHR-YVR is F in a 777, with a connection on Alaska from SEA-YVR (an E175).
It was actually kinda tricky to book. When clicking through from Google Flights to BA, BA would say “First Class was not available for some flights” and put me in Economy instead. The only way to get around this was to do a manual multi-city search on BA’s website with the itinerary I found from Google Flights, and for any city pairs with connections that partially included a flight without F (such as the A350) I had to break those out into their own pairs in the search. Then I’d manually select J for the A350 and F for all the other segments. Took a bit to figure that all out.
Also, the price Google Flights would show when selecting the last flight of the itinerary is actually more money than the (correct) price it would show on the final Google Flights itinerary page. Weird.

Base Miles: 20,688
Class Bonus 500%: 103,440
100K Elite Miles 150%: 31,032
75K / 100K Threshold Bonus: 20,688
TOTAL: 175,848
